The Spiral Logo Carousel scatters small colourful marks along a widening curl that turns slowly around a single word. Chips near the centre sit small and faint, growing larger and bolder as the spiral sweeps outward, so the whole surface reads as a galaxy in rotation.
When to use it
Reach for it when the roster itself is colourful and characterful: marketplaces full of independent makers, creative communities, font foundries, app stores. It celebrates variety, so it suits brands whose partners are the product rather than a credential.
Why it works
Most logo sections ask logos to behave; this one lets them play. The spiral turns a list into a spectacle, and the size falloff toward the centre creates depth that flat grids cannot touch. Visitors watch it the way they watch a mobile above a cot, and the word at the centre quietly claims credit for the whole constellation.
